Richard Ebeling is currently a professor of economics at Northwood University. He was the president of the Foundation for Economic Education from 2003 to 2008 and has published several books on Ludwig von Mises and Austrian economics.

In this Future of Freedom Foundation talk from 1994, Ebeling shares his findings from a recent trip to Austrian economist Ludwig von Mises’s hometown of Vienna. Ebeling undertook the research project to find out more about the economist’s personal life and background and managed to uncover many new primary source documents surrounding Mises’s life in Austria as a soldier in World War I, a student (and later, professor) of economics at the University of Vienna, and as secretary at the Vienna Chamber of Commerce.
